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beggar'S-Buttons | narrow alkaligrass |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Liliopsida (Monocots) |
| Order |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) | Poales (Grasses) |
| Family |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) | Poaceae (Grass Family) |
| Genus | Arctium | Puccinellia |
| Species | Arctium lappa | Puccinellia angustata |
Evolutionary Relationship
Beggar'S-Buttons and narrow alkaligrass share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)

Habitat & Geographic Range
Beggar'S-Buttons
Inhabits temperate coniferous forests within the Palearctic biogeographic realm.
Widely distributed across Africa (Algeria), Asia (North Korea, Taiwan), Europe (11 countries), North America (Canada, United States), and South America (Brazil).
narrow alkaligrass
Typically found in grasslands, wetlands, forests, and cultivated landscapes.
Distributed across Canada, Norway, and Sweden.
